## Changelog — Ticktrace 1.9

### Renamed: DRIFT_API_TOKEN
During the cron drift investigation we found plugins confusing this variable with the metrics token, so it has been renamed to indicate it authorizes drift-report uploads specifically. Plugin authors must read the new name from 1.9 onward; the old name is ignored without warning. Sample env files in the SDK are updated. In your deployment env file, the drift-report upload secret is set on the next line.

env line for fawef-taguf: VAULT_KEY13=a9695905a9a90

Re: Fabrikit factory defaults — support folks will hit this. The new `build_bulk` helper silently caps record counts, so repro scripts generating large datasets will truncate without warning. Please document the cap before merge; otherwise tickets about "missing rows" will land on us. The limits baked into this change are:

tuning table, yajog-yahof:
BUDGETS = {
    "lamvan": 303,
    "wenox": 460,
    "fenvan": 525,
}

Ticket: Missed pick-up – Medical cooler, Quarrow Field Clinic

Courier from Brindlevane Transit did not arrive for the 09:00 cooler collection at Quarrow Field Clinic. Two coolers with lab specimens are still on site; ice packs hold until roughly 15:00. Clinic staff cannot leave post to re-stage. Rebooked with Brindlevane for a 13:30 slot, confirmed by their desk. Office manager: please log the miss against the vendor and confirm the afternoon run. The replacement courier must follow the hand-over instruction below without deviation.

handover note for yagef-bagep: the drudor pelius courier leaves the kasdor zorvan norir ledger at gate 8016 under passcode 755406

## Service account: sitegen-rebuilder

The sitegen-rebuilder account triggers incremental rebuilds on Pagemill whenever content changes land in Draftbox. Scope is limited to rebuild and cache-invalidation endpoints; it cannot read source content. Rotation happens quarterly and is logged in the audit channel. The account authenticates with the key shown below.

app token of tagef-tafog = qvz3-7n0